A growing environmental consultancy is seeking an experienced Senior Ecologist to join its expanding team. Working across a diverse portfolio of infrastructure, utilities, and development projects, you will play a key role in delivering technical ecological services, managing projects, and supporting the development of junior team members.

This role offers a balance of fieldwork, project management, technical reporting, and stakeholder engagement, providing excellent opportunities for career progression within a collaborative and supportive environment.

The Role

Key responsibilities include:

  • Leading and managing protected species surveys and ecological fieldwork.
  • Acting as the technical ecology lead on a variety of projects from inception through to delivery.
  • Undertaking UKHab surveys and Biodiversity Net Gain assessments, including metric calculations.
  • Acting as Ecological Clerk of Works (ECoW) and overseeing environmental compliance on site.
  • Producing and reviewing technical reports, including Ecological Impact Assessments (EcIA), Habitats Regulations Assessments (HRA) and protected species licence applications.
  • Supporting project management, programme delivery, and commercial performance.
  • Mentoring junior ecologists and undertaking technical review of reports and survey outputs.
  • Building strong relationships with clients, contractors, and project stakeholders.

About You

  • Degree qualified in Ecology or a related environmental discipline.
  • Minimum 4 years' ecological consultancy or relevant sector experience.
  • Holder of protected species licences, including dormouse and bat licences.
  • Full or Associate CIEEM membership, ideally working towards chartership.
  • Strong understanding of ecology, environmental legislation, planning processes, and Biodiversity Net Gain.
  • Experience managing surveys, projects, and technical report production.
  • Competent user of bat analysis software and GIS mapping tools.
  • Excellent organisational, communication, and stakeholder management skills.
  • Full UK driving licence and willingness to travel, including occasional overnight stays.

Desirable Experience

  • Additional protected species licences (e.g. GCN, reptiles, badger).
  • Experience delivering projects within highways, rail, or development sectors.
  • Experience preparing licence applications and environmental assessments.
  • Knowledge of HRA, EcIA, and wider environmental reporting processes.
